#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 306 # 305 contd. The research indicated that a two week gap in the availability of forage to a #bumblebee colony during March/April could result in up to a 90% reduction in numbers of daughter queens subsequently produced. #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 300 The back & forth motion of bumblebee wings create vortices in the air like tiny hurricanes the eyes of which have lower pressure than the surrounding air and keeping those eddies of air above the wings helps #bees stay aloft.
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 295 # 294 contd. At this late stage in the nest cycle bumblebee workers can sometimes try to eat eggs laid by the queen who may try to maintain dominance by eating worker laid eggs, head-butting workers & even biting them! #bees

#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 307 Research suggests that protecting/enhancing existing #hedgerows with early blooming species like #willow, hawthorn, ground ivy, red dead-nettle, maple & cherry could improve bumblebee colony success rate from 35-100%. #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 306 # 305 contd. The research indicated that a two week gap in the availability of forage to a #bumblebee colony during March/April could result in up to a 90% reduction in numbers of daughter queens subsequently produced. #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 305 # 304 contd Larvae drive demand for food in #bumblebee colonies but where are these resources deployed? The larvae require POLLEN for GROWTH… and THERMAL regulation of the brood uses up most of the energy from NECTAR. #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 304 # 303 contd. Research found that a bumblebee colony’s demand for nectar and pollen is a function of the number of larvae in the nest rather than the number of active female adult workers. #bees #nature #science #education

#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 301 Recent research analysing trends in virus and parasite transmission in bees, by season, indicates that honey bees likely play a role in increasing virus levels in wild #bumblebees each spring. #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 300 The back & forth motion of bumblebee wings create vortices in the air like tiny hurricanes the eyes of which have lower pressure than the surrounding air and keeping those eddies of air above the wings helps #bees stay aloft.
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 299 Heat-stress research indicated not only that female worker #bees struggle more than males in adapting to unusually high temperatures but also wild #bumblebees seem more affected than ‘commercially manufactured’ bumblebees. 🐝
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 298 Bumblebee antennae (which the #bees use to ‘smell’) that had been exposed to 40°C heat events continued to have greatly impaired scent responses 24 hours later (in cooler ‘normal’ temps) and no consistent pattern of recovery.
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 297 The effects on #bumblebees of exposure to a simulated extreme temperature event appeared more severe in female workers reducing ability to smell floral scents by up to 80%. Male #bees were less affected with a 50% reduction.

#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 175. The world’s largest bumblebee is Bombus dahlbomii. Found in Patagonia queens can be 4cm long. Unfortunately now in serious trouble due to European #bumblebees being introduced to pollinate greenhouse crops since 1997. #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No.61. Bumblebee queens prefer to hibernate in north facing slopes sheltered from the sun as these areas are later to heat up in Spring and so help prevent the queens from emerging too early. #bees #bumblebees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No 25. Pollination is the act of transferring pollen grains from the male anther of a flower to the female stigma. Pollinators are animals that facilitate this transfer. Bees are kick-ass pollinators. To be continued… #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No 48. What #bees see. Flowers evolved to attract bees/insects. Many have ultraviolet ‘nectar guides’ of ‘bee purple’ which are not visible to the human eye but a beacon to bees, pointing them to the #nectar/pollen source.
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No 47. Colours #bees see. For bees the visible spectrum starts in the yellow shades of orange, is at its highest in the bright blues and continues down into ultraviolet. They don’t see reds/maroon. Ability to see UV is vital.
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. #16. It is often thought that hummingbirds have the highest metabolic rate (energy used per unit of time) of all animals however the metabolic rate of bumblebees is 75% higher. ‘I love not man less, but Nature more’ - Byron #bees

#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No. 364. Bee circulatory system - quick version! Tubular heart pulses & waves of contractions push the blood inside the tube towards the head end. Blood at the head slowly forced back to the abdomen to be pushed forward again. #bees

#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 148. #corbiculae rock! = bee pollen baskets/sacs. These bee ‘saddle bags’ are smooth indents surrounded by stiff hairs on the tibia of the hind legs of some #female #bees. Used to carry collected #pollen back to the nest.
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No 42. Great flowers to have in your garden: Knapweed - Greater & Lesser, Vetch - Bush and Tufted, Bird’s-Foot Trefoil, Clovers, Phacelia, Borage, Sunflower, Calendula, Musk Mallow, Dandelion, Scabious, Thistle, Cosmos..1/2 #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No. 58. Relatively hardy & capable of vibrating their bodies to create heat, bumblebees are able to forage in cooler temperatures than honey bees. They can begin foraging earlier in the day & continue later into the evening. #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. # 13 Bees have five eyes. Two compound eyes on the side of the head and three simple eyes in between. ‘Come forth into the light of things, let nature be your teacher’ - Wordsworth #bees #nature #solitarybees

#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No 36. No 35 contd.. If a single raised leg doesn’t warn you off a #bumblebee will often raise more legs. If you persist she’ll go belly up to reveal her stinger. Males do likewise but are bluffing - they have no stinger! #bees
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No 51. As with all insects #bees have exoskeletons. Their skeleton is on the outside. Once they have hatched from their cocoons as adults they cannot grow any bigger.
#theBeeAt3 Basic bee facts every day at 3pm. No. 59. #Bumblebees have four wings. The two back wings are smaller and are usually attached to the bigger front wings by a row of hooks. This can sometimes lead to the mistaken impression that they only have two wings. #bees
